Power Control
The LightningVolt Button works like a power switch to activate/deactivate your lithium boat battery. Use the LightningVolt Button when you intend to store the battery for an extended period. By deactivating the battery, the power consumption of the Battery Management System (BMS) is reduced to zero, enabling the battery to be stored without experiencing a drop in voltage or state of charge. It even shields the battery from parasitic draws which means you can store your battery in your boat, connected to your trolling motor, for extended periods without removing the battery terminal connections.
It’s also a battery safety mechanism! We recommend using the LightningVolt Button to deactivate the battery to ensure user safety and to prevent shorting out components while working on the boat’s battery circuit and during transportation.
Safety Vent
For even more safety, our engineers include a pressure release valve in the battery case design. In a catastrophic event where the cells overheat or rupture, the vent will release instead.

Onboard DC-DC Charge/Isolator
The LightningVolt DC to DC charger was loved by many users of our first gen design so our engineers made it a built-in feature on our new battery! The LightningVolt DC-DC onboard charger allows the battery to be charged by any 12-36V DC input can be used, like your alternator or solar array. We include this on every battery to enable direct charging without the addition of an isolator, switchgear, diode, or MPPT controller!
To prevent overloading your boat’s alternator, the charger smartly lowers input to 10A. It also incorporates an automatic disconnect feature to safeguard against draining your watercraft’s starting battery. Additional DC-DC chargers can be connected in parallel for faster charging. Or a compatible lithium charger can still be connected to the battery terminals for AC or rapid charging.
The DC-DC charger can also be wired to use your LightningVolt battery as an input source allowing you to draw a 12V current out of your 24V LightningVolt battery bank to charge a 12V lead acid starting battery or to power 12V graphs, sonar, or power poles!
BMS with Precise Safety Conditions
LightningVolt™ batteries are equipped with a built-in battery management system (BMS) that incorporates several safety features to protect the battery and enhance its lifespan. The LightningVolt batteries BMS features distinctive self-resetting cell protection, meaning that if the BMS trips to protect the battery, it will come back online automatically.
LightningVolt batteries have a high voltage disconnect feature, which prevents damage if an individual cell voltage exceeds the preset threshold. A similar feature is the low voltage disconnect, where the BMS prevents failure if an individual cell falls below the preset threshold. The BMS also includes thermal management protections, high current discharge surges, and short circuits, and is the first lithium battery to be freeze-cycle tested and vibration tested.
